The Benefits of Learning at Home

When therapy happens in your home, your child practices skills in the exact environment where they'll use them. This leads to better skill generalization—meaning what they learn during therapy naturally becomes part of their everyday life.

Home-based sessions also eliminate travel stress, fit more easily into your family's schedule, and allow our therapists to work with your child using their own toys, rooms, and routines—making learning feel natural and engaging.

Session length varies based on your child's treatment plan and needs—typically ranging from 2 to 4 hours. Younger children may have shorter sessions, while older children working on more complex skills may benefit from longer sessions. Your BCBA will recommend the optimal duration for your child.

Our therapists come prepared with any specialized materials needed for your child's treatment goals. However, we also use your child's own toys and items from around the house—this helps make learning more natural and relevant to their daily life.

Yes! Involving siblings can be incredibly beneficial for practicing social skills and creating more natural learning opportunities. Your therapist will work with you to determine when and how sibling involvement is appropriate based on your child's goals.

A responsible adult must be present in the home during all sessions. However, you don't need to be in the same room the entire time. Many parents use this time to complete household tasks while remaining available. Parent involvement in portions of each session is encouraged for training purposes.
